City Guide
Vallo Torinese, Piedmont, Italy
Overview
Vallo Torinese is a charming village situated at the foothills of the Alps, just north of Turin in the Piedmont region. With under 800 residents, it offers a tranquil rural atmosphere and picturesque surroundings ideal for nature lovers and those seeking authentic Italian village life.
Best Time to Visit
April-June and September for mild weather and fewer crowds.
Local Tips
A car is recommended for exploring the area and nearby valleys. Local shops close midday, so plan meals and purchases accordingly.
Cultural Etiquette
Dress modestly, especially when visiting churches; tipping is appreciated but not expected (round up or leave small change in restaurants). Greet locals with a friendly 'Buongiorno.'
Safety Warnings
This village is very safe; exercise standard precautions for valuables and be careful driving narrow country roads, especially in winter.
Hidden Gems
Discover the ancient stone bridge near San Sebastiano, hike to panoramic viewpoints in Zona Collinare, and visit the historic parish church in Centro Storico.
